Job Description As a Security Officer - Unarmed Patrol in Cookeville, TN, you will serve and safeguard clients in a range of industries such as Financial Institutions, and more. As an unarmed Patrol Officer at a financial institution location, you will monitor and patrol assigned areas, conduct routine rounds, and maintain a visible presence that helps to deter security-related incidents. You will document observations, communicate clearly with staff and visitors, and deliver responsive customer service. What You'll Do: Provide customer service to employees, visitors, and/or vendors at a financial institution location by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and when appropriate, emergency response activities. Respond to alarms, access control concerns, and/or other incidents in a calm, problem-solving manner, coordinating with site contacts and public services as needed. Conduct regular and random unarmed patrols of interior areas such as lobbies, corridors, and ATM or night deposit areas, as well as exterior building and parking lot areas, as assigned. Monitor for unusual activity and/or unsecured doors, review assigned cameras or alarm panels when available, and document observations and incidents according to post orders. Complete routine reports such as shift activity logs and incident reports, communicate updates to Allied Universal supervision, and support client service needs within the scope of post instructions.
